Why Carrier Oils For Hair & Skin is a Must-Have in Your Beauty Routine

Carrier oils are important for both haircare and skincare. They act as a base for essential oils. moreover, it is safe to use on the scalp and skin. However, the benefits are not just limited to diluting essential oils.

All carrier oil have their unique properties that provide deep nourishment, and promote the overall health of the skin and hair while restoring moisture as well. Here are the reasons mentioned why you should include them in your routine.

Deep Moisture

Carrier oils are rich in vitamins and healthy fats. They have hydrating properties and leaves the skin smooth and soft. They trap the moisture in and protect the skin from external environmental factors.

Natural and Gentle

Carrier oils do not have any fragrances or harsh chemicals. So, if you have sensitive skin and looking for a natural skincare solution carrier oils should be your pick.

Boosts Skin and Hair Health

Many carrier oils have antioxidants and vitamins for promoting skin cell regeneration, nourishing the scalp, and improving elasticity. This makes the hair stronger and shinier, and your complexion becomes even toned.

Versatility

Carrier oils are used in various ways. It is used in hair treatment as well as DIY beauty recipes. Moreover, it is an amazing daily moisturizer and is often used in hair treatments. The versatile use of these oils makes them a wonderful addition to your beauty collection.

Top Carrier Oils for Hair and Skin Care

Here’s a closer look at some of the best carrier oils for hair and skin, and their unique benefits:

Vitamin E Oil

Here are the benefits of vitamin E oil mentioned.

  • Benefits: It has powerful antioxidants that protect the skin from environmental damage.
  • Skin Type: It is suitable for dry, mature, and sun-damaged skin.
  • Uses: It is used for reducing fine lines and wrinkles. It improves skin texture and promotes healthy skin.
  • Perfect For: It is best for healing scars and anti-aging treatments.

Moringa Carrier Oil

The usefulness and benefits of Moringa Carrier Oil are mentioned below.

  • Benefits: It is rich in vitamins A, C, and E, and antioxidants.
  • Skin Type: It is perfect for dry, dull, or aging skin.
  • Uses: Nourishes skin, boosts collagen production, and provides a radiant glow.
  • Perfect For: Reducing inflammation, restoring skin elasticity, and preventing signs of aging.

Rosehip Carrier Oil

Rosehip carrier oil has the following uses:

  • Benefits: Packed with vitamin C and essential fatty acids.
  • Skin Type: Great for dry, damaged, or hyperpigmented skin.
  • Uses: Helps lighten scars, even skin tone, and reduce signs of aging.
  • Perfect For: Skin regeneration, brightening, and treating acne scars.

Pomegranate Carrier Oil

Pomegranate Carrier Oil has the following benefits.

  • Benefits: It is rich in antioxidants and helps protect the skin from free radical damage.
  • Skin Type: It is best for dry or sun-damaged skin.
  • Uses: It promotes collagen production, reduces signs of aging, and deeply hydrates.
  • Perfect For: Fighting aging, tightening skin, and restoring skin’s natural glow.

Argan Carrier Oil

Argan Oil has the following benefits:

  • Benefits: Packed with essential fatty acids and vitamin E.
  • Skin Type: Suitable for dry, mature, and sensitive skin.
  • Uses: Deeply hydrates, restores moisture, and prevents environmental damage.
  • Perfect For: Moisturizing and treating dry, flaky skin, and promoting healthy hair.

Primrose Carrier Oil

The benefits and usage of Primrose Carrier Oil are mentioned below.

  • Benefits: Known for its soothing properties and high gamma-linolenic acid (GLA).
  • Skin Type: Ideal for sensitive, irritated, or inflamed skin.
  • Uses: Helps alleviate eczema, psoriasis, and other skin conditions.
  • Perfect For: Calming skin irritation, and inflammation, and improving moisture retention.

Jojoba Carrier Oil

Let’s check the benefits and usage of Jojoba Oil.

  • Benefits: Mimics the skin’s natural oils, making it great for oil control.
  • Skin Type: Perfect for oily and acne-prone skin.
  • Uses: Hydrates without clogging pores, balances sebum production, and soothes irritation.
  • Perfect For: Balancing oil production and improving skin clarity.

Natural Pure Sweet Almond Oil

The benefits and usage of Natural Almond Oil are mentioned below.

  • Benefits: Rich in vitamins A and E, which help brighten the skin and reduce puffiness.
  • Skin Type: Suitable for all skin types, especially sensitive skin.
  • Uses: Moisturizes, improves skin tone, and soothes irritation.
  • Perfect For: Gentle, everyday hydration and calming inflamed skin.

Jamaican Black Castor Oil

Jamaican Black Castor Oil has various benefits and uses. Those are mentioned below.

  • Benefits: Rich in ricinoleic acid, promoting hair growth and scalp health.
  • Hair Type: Ideal for dry, brittle, or thinning hair.
  • Uses: Stimulates hair follicles, strengthens hair, and prevents hair loss.
  • Perfect For: Promoting healthy hair growth and nourishing a dry, itchy scalp.

Natural Shea Butter & Vitamin E Moisturizing Oil

Natural shea butter and Vitamin E oil come with certain benefits and fit a certain skin type. Let’s check those.

  • Benefits: It is a lightweight oil, that provides great moisture without making your skin greasy.
  • Skin Type: It is perfect for all skin types.
  • Uses: It traps moisture, thus hydrates and softens the skin.
  • Perfect For: You can use it as an all-over moisturizer for daily use. It will give you smooth and soft skin.

Coconut Milk and Black Castor Body Moisturizing Oil

The uses of coconut milk and black castor oil have the following uses:

  • Benefits: It combines the best properties from both oils and thus hydrates and restores damaged skin.
  • Skin Type: It is suitable for sensitive and dry skin.
  • Uses: It deeply moisturizes and restores damaged skin. Moreover, it improves elasticity.
  • Perfect For: Retains moisture and nourishes rough, dry skin.

How to Choose the Right Carrier Oil for Your Skin and Hair

You should choose carrier oils for hair and skin depending on the requirements of your skin and hair. Here is how you should choose.

  • Dry Skin: If you need to hydrate your skin, you can use Argan Oil, Pomegranate Oil, and Rosehip Oil. They lock the moisture in and improve skin elasticity, making it soft and supple.
  • Oily Skin: If you have oily skin, then use jojoba oil to balance the oil production which keeps the skin hydrated.
  • Sensitive Skin: If your skin gets easily irritated, then sweet Almond Oil and Primrose Oil are perfect for you.
  • Hair Growth: Jamaican Black Castor Oil and Moringa Oil nourish the scalp and promote healthy hair growth. These make the hair strong, prevent breakage, and give you thick and shiny hair.

Usage Tips For Carrier Oils

Here are some of the tips that you should use for making the most of carrier oils.

  • Apply After a Shower: These oils work best when you apply them on damp skin. After showering, pat the skin dry and apply carrier oil for maximum moisture absorption.
  • Hair Treatment: Massage the oil into your hair and scalp for nourishment and stimulating growth. For best results leave it overnight and if you don’t have time leave it on for at least 30 minutes.
  • Mix with Essential Oils: You can combine carrier oils with essential oils to make customized oils for your hair and skin. just ensure that you dilute the essential oils to avoid any kind of irritation.
  • Store in a Cool, Dark Place: Store the carrier oil in a cool and dark place to keep it fresh and potent. keep it away from direct sunlight.

Frequently Asked Questions

People often ask these few questions when discussing carrier oil from hair and skin. 

How do I know which carrier oil is right for my skin type?

Every carrier oil has its unique properties and benefits your skin the way it needs. If you have dry skin you should apply Pomegranate Oil and Agran Oil. If you have oily skin, then Jojoba Oil is the best fit. it balances oil protection. For sensitive skin Primrose Oil and Sweet Almond Oil are suitable.

Can I use carrier oils on my face?

Carrier oil is safe to use on the face. However, if you have acne-prone skin or sensitive skin, go with light oils, like Jojoba oil or Rosehip oil. This will help balance oil protection and keep the won’t clog the pores.

Can I use carrier oils for my hair?

Using carrier oil for hair is beneficial. Use moringa Oil or Black Castor Oil to promote hair growth and prevent hair loss. Massage it into the scalp and leave it overnight or at least for a few hours.

Are carrier oils safe for all ages?

Carrier oils are mostly safe and gentle for all ages and that includes children. However, you should consult a doctor if you are using it on infants and young children. More so, if they have sensitive skin.

Can I mix different carrier oils?

You can mix carrier oils with other oils to create a personalized hair and skin regimen. Mix rosehip and Jojoba oil for hydration. You can also mix Pomegranate Oil and Argan to get some improvement from radical damage.

Less waste – Something You can Do for the World

Any ideas for a new year’s resolution in 2019? Here is one – first look back to 2018 (or any year before) and try to count all the times you had to take out the trash. Impossible? That can be so because we tend to produce an enormous amount of waste. According to EPA research, one person in the United States produces up to 2,000 pounds of trash a year, less than half of which can be recycled. There are, on the other hand, people proud of producing only one jar of waste in a year. Can it be possible for an average person? Here are some tips to produce less waste and therefore care more for mother earth. How much do I really waste? The first thing to do is a little reflection on your life. However disgusting it may sound you should look through your trash and see which items are the majority of your waste. Maybe paper cups? Plastic forks? Paper tissues? By doing so you’ll immediately see, what to focus on and what kind of waste should you limit the most. Little swaps: It can seem harsh to immediately switch your lifestyle to zero waste, but in reality, you don’t need to do everything at once. Little swaps in your daily life can already be meaningful and help the environment. This can be a bamboo toothbrush instead of the plastic ones, a bag made of paper instead of the plastic ones, stainless steel Tupperware instead of – guess what? – plastic ones. So, in general, avoiding plastic is not that difficult if you make little changes. Avoid packaging: The best thing would be to use no plastic packages at all, but that can be hard. So just do your best to limit it as much as possible. Try to buy your fruits and vegetables at a local market instead of the supermarket and don’t forget to bring your own bag. Some markets offer food sold in loose weight, so you can buy them in your own containers, like Tupperware or mason jars. Also, if you buy a piece of clothing, maybe it’s not always necessary to take it in a plastic bag with the logo of the shop? Go for sustainability: In addition to what was written above, you should consider choosing sustainable products. The biggest amount of waste comes from disposable items that are thrown away after one use. Things like a reusable water bottle to avoid buying plastic bottles every day, bamboo cutlery that you carry around to use for your takeaways, or a tote bag for your groceries can make a big impact and help you produce less waste. There are a lot of things that can be changed to sustainable options – from paper tissues and menstrual pads to straws and cutlery. You can also get sustainable homeware made of natural and recycled materials as an alternative to regular homeware. Of course, it can take a bit more effort at the beginning, to carry your own cup of bottle everywhere, but the earth will be a little lighter. Try second hand! Many of the trash that is being thrown away, could be reused. Maybe some plastic containers of butter or hummus that you already ate, could be reused as Tupperware? Or maybe an empty shampoo bottle could serve as a DIY hand soap container? Also consider buying second-hand items like furniture, clothes or other things. You don’t always have to have a brand new thing, right? Do it yourself! In our society, it can be hard to avoid plastic packed things. A solution to that would be to do those things yourself. Online you can find many recipes for great cookies (to avoid buying them packed in plastic bags), cosmetics (many of them are sold in plastic bottles that are hard to reuse or recycle), or liquid cleaners for your home. Again, it takes some time and effort to do everything yourself, but it’s also rewarding, when you discover, that you don’t need to buy this stuff anymore, cause you can do it on your own. Change your lifestyle and save money! It’s not possible to change your waste without changing your lifestyle. But it doesn’t have to be that difficult, many of the changes have other advantages than only helping the planet. For example, when you switch from disposable menstrual pads to a menstrual cup, you save a lot of money every month. Characteristics of The Best Wine Clubs

3 Characteristics of The Best Wine Clubs You Can Join as An Avid Wine Drinker!

One way to sample various international and domestic wines in the comfort of your home is through a quarterly or monthly wine club membership. Since most wine clubs concentrate on featuring small boutique vintages and wineries, you will get to experience really unique wines that you never would find in a local wine shop. Below is a discussion on the 3 characteristics of a good wine club: Offers Multiple Options for Membership: Besides providing flexible shipping schedules, most wine clubs offer several membership options without any minimum purchasing requirements. Nearly every club also will enable you to cancel at any point without incurring cancellation fees. Based upon your budget for wine, you’ll initially be choosing between membership to a premium wine club or a value wine club. Costs greatly vary depending upon the club you select and your membership level, yet the least expensive clubs begin at about $30 for a 2-bottle shipment. A premium wine club may cost as high as $700 for a 2-bottle shipment, learn more about wine clubs. The kind of wine you need to receive will narrow down your search further. If the membership includes two or more bottles per month, the best wine clubs will enable you to select if you want to get shipments only of red wines, only white wine, or a combination of the two. The best wine clubs will provide various international and domestic wines, while other ones only concentrate on specific varieties or regions. The Best Wine Clubs Are Selective About Their Wine Selection Process: Something to take a closer look at is how a wine club makes its choices every month. It’s important while researching the value clubs since you may not want a discount or bulk bin deals. Usually, the best wine clubs have a panel of specialists who pre-screen wines for value, quality, and uniqueness every month before sending the best bottles out to members. Some wines have a numerical rating assigned to them. While the point system is a helpful guide while judging the quality of a wine, remember that those ratings are subjective, and you should always consider the source. Are Able to Reorder Favorite Wines: Unfortunately, some clubs do not provide a convenient re-ordering system online if you want to purchase more bottles of a specific wine you like. Liquor laws differ depending upon what state you reside in, so it may be really annoying if you attempt to re-order wine directly from the winery or from a different distributor. When you’re reviewing the best wine clubs, you definitely should verify to see if you will have the ability to reorder specific bottles and what type of discounts are given. Occasionally those discounts may be as high as 50 percent off direct winery prices. Wine club memberships are the ideal gift to provide yourself or any wine lover in your life. Since most clubs just feature boutique vintages and wineries, it’s a suitable method of discovering incredible wines that you’d never have otherwise had the chance to try.
